Elise Stefanik, RN.Y., told Hannity on Thursday that the count of coronavirus deaths among New York City nursing home residents was “a massive corruption scandal at the highest level.”
State Department of Health commissioner Howard Zucker confirmed earlier Thursday that at least 12,743 long-term residents died of COVID-19 on January 19 this year, more than 4,200 more than the official version on that day.
State Attorney General Letitia James accused in a report released earlier that the death toll in the nursing home could be down by about 50%. Zucker’s figure confirmed for the first time 3829 deaths of COVID-19 among residents of nursing homes transported to hospitals.
